Designing the Perfect Game Room: Making the Most of Limited Space
Even if your living area is on the smaller side, that doesn’t mean you can’t carve out a dedicated space for fun and games. With a little creativity and some smart design choices, you can transform a nook or corner into an inviting game room that maximizes both entertainment and functionality. Here’s a comprehensive guide to help you craft the perfect game room for your small space:
Space Planning and Furniture Selection
Prioritize Functionality: First, assess the types of games you’ll be playing and how many people you’ll be entertaining. This will determine the layout and furniture you’ll need.
Multi-Functional Furniture is Key: Opt for furniture that serves multiple purposes. Ottomans with storage compartments can provide extra seating and hold board games. A futon can double as a couch for lounging and a bed for sleepovers. Folding Tables and Chairs: Folding tables and chairs offer great flexibility. They can be easily stored away when not in use, freeing up valuable floor space.Wall-Mounted Solutions: Utilize your walls! Install floating shelves to display board games and controllers. Consider a wall-mounted TV to save on floor space and improve viewing angles for everyone. Storage and Organization
Vertical Storage is Your Friend: Take advantage of vertical space with tall cabinets or bookcases. Utilize ottomans and benches with built-in storage to keep games, controllers, and accessories organized.
Label Everything: Clearly label shelves and drawers to make finding games and accessories a breeze. This will not only save time but also prevent clutter buildup. Pegboards and Hooks: Wall-mounted pegboards and hooks are fantastic for storing controllers, board game pieces, and other gaming essentials, keeping them easily accessible and off the floor. Creating the Ambiance
Lighting is Key: Lighting sets the mood! Install dimmer switches to adjust the ambiance depending on the game or activity. Consider rope lighting or LED strips to create a fun and inviting atmosphere.
Mirrors Open Up the Space: Strategic placement of mirrors can create the illusion of a larger space. This is a great space-saving trick for small game rooms. Themed Decor: Infuse your personality into the space! Decorate with video game posters, board game artwork, or sports memorabilia to reflect your gaming tastes. Area Rugs: Area rugs not only define the game room space but also add comfort and warmth. Choose a rug size and color that complements your overall design scheme. Small Space Game Room Ideas: Geared for Different Activities
Board Game Bonanza: A designated board game area can be easily created in a small space. A foldable table and comfortable chairs tucked into a corner with nearby shelves for storing games is all you need.
The Retro Arcade Vibe: Recreate the nostalgia of a classic arcade with a mini fridge for drinks, a comfortable seating area, and a wall-mounted TV showcasing your favorite retro gaming console. The Solo Gamer’s Sanctuary: For the solo gamer, a comfy beanbag chair, a small side table for your console, and a mounted TV can create the perfect haven for immersive gaming experiences.Remember: Don’t be afraid to experiment and personalize your small game room! With a little planning and creativity, you can create a space that’s both functional and fun, the perfect place to unwind, relax, and enjoy some quality game time.
